site stats

Cheapest insertion heuristic python code

Webcheapest insertion (as in step 3 of Nearest In-sertion). Then chose the city with the least cost/increase ratio, and insert it. 3. Repeat step 2 until no more cities remain. 3.4. Christofides Most heuristics can only guarante a worst-case ratio of 2 (i.e. a tour with twice the length of the optimal tour). Professor Nicos Christofides extended ... WebFeb 19, 2015 · I enjoyed the first look at the code as it's very clean, you have extensive docstrings and great, expressive function names. Now you know the deal with PEP8, but …

python - Travelling salesman using brute-force and …

http://download.garuda.kemdikbud.go.id/article.php?article=2917926&val=25669&title=Implementasi%20Algoritma%20Cheapest%20Insertion%20Heuristic%20dalam%20Menentukan%20Rute%20Pengiriman%20Barang Web15 rows · Jan 16, 2024 · Here's the Python code to print the status of a search: … leghorn road nw10 https://mjengr.com

python - Travelling salesman using brute-force and heuristics - Code …

WebCheapest Insertion input A weighted graph G = (V;E). begin k;l := argminfcij +cji: i;j 2 V;i 6= jg: T := (k;l;k). while T is a partial tour v := argminfc(T;k) : k 2= Tg. T := insert(T;v). end … Web9 1. For each vertex i ∈ V’ define the subtour (k, i, k); order the arcs (i, j) ∈ A (with i ∈ V’, j ∈ V’) according to non-increasing values of the corresponding savings s ij. 2. If the insertion of the next arc (i, j) into the current solution (given by a family of subtours passing through k) is feasible, i.e. the current WebCheapest Insertion Step 1. Start with a sub-graph consisting of node i only. Step 2. Find node rsuch that ciris minimal and form sub-tour i-r-i. Step 3. Find (i, j)in sub-tour and rnot, … leghorn ranch pitt meadows

logistics-opt-python/cheapest_insertion_simple.py at master - Github

Category:11 Animated Algorithms for the Traveling Salesman Problem - STEM Lo…

Tags:Cheapest insertion heuristic python code

Cheapest insertion heuristic python code

The Traveling Salesman Problem - University of California, …

WebApr 18, 2024 · It supports many web technologies such as CSS, Java, and JavaScript. 2. Jupyter. Jupyter is another best IDE for Python Programming that offers an easy-to-use, … WebA simple example of this type of algorithm is the: 2-Opt Algorithm This algorithm starts from either a random tour or from the tour that resulted from the nearest neighbor heuristic. …

Cheapest insertion heuristic python code

Did you know?

WebFeb 20, 2024 · The code sets the first solution strategy to PATH_CHEAPEST_ARC , which creates an initial route for the solver by repeatedly adding edges with the least weight … Web2 days ago · Approach: To add two hexadecimal values in python we will first convert them into decimal values then add them and then finally again convert them to a hexadecimal …

WebOct 20, 2024 · Python code for visualizations of algorithms that provide approximate solutions to TSP along with two lower bound approximations graph-algorithms greedy nearest-neighbor convex-hull tsp christofides adjacency … WebFeb 25, 2014 · The Farthest Insertion’s heuristic consists of two basic actions: searching for the farthest free vertex (one that isn’t yet in the tour) from the tour; ... Type Check Your Python Code 13 minute read I was recently surprised to discover that a module called typing had been added to Python 3, providing the fundamental building blocks for ...

WebMethod Parallel Cheapest Insertion merupakan fitur yang terdapat pada salah satu module yang tersedia pada Python dan method tersebut dapat membantu …

WebFeb 20, 2024 · The code sets the first solution strategy to PATH_CHEAPEST_ARC , which creates an initial route for the solver by repeatedly adding edges with the least weight that don't lead to a previously visited node (other than the depot). For other options, see First solution strategy.

http://www.math.tau.ac.il/%7Ehassin/tsp_regret.pdf leghorn rooster factshttp://www.math.tau.ac.il/%7Ehassin/tsp_regret.pdf leghorns athens ohioWebDec 1, 2024 · Cheapest insertion heuristics algorithm to optimize WIP product distributions in FBS Fashion Industry. WN Tanjung1, N Nurhasanah1, QA Suri1, Jingga1, B … leghorns chickens for saleWebAug 21, 2024 · A library to solve the TSP (Travelling Salesman Problem) using Exact Algorithms, Heuristics and Metaheuristics : 2-opt; 2.5-opt; 3-opt; 4-opt; 5-opt; 2-opt Stochastic; 2.5-opt Stochastic; 3-opt Stochastic; 4-opt Stochastic; 5-opt Stochastic; Ant Colony Optimization; Bellman-Held-Karp Exact Algorithm; Branch & Bound; BRKGA … leghorns chicksWeb(Insertion step) Find the arc (i, j) in the sub-tour which minimizes c ir + c rj - c ij. Insert r between i and j. Step 5. If all the nodes are added to the tour, stop. Else go to step 3 Note how the underlined sections differ from "nearest insertion". Worst Case Behavior: Number of Computations: The farthest insertion algorithm is leghorn security sealsWebvariant of the cheapest insertion algorithm for the TSP. Our numerical study indicates that in most cases it signi cantly reduces the relative error, and the added computational time is quite small. Keywords: Cheapest insertion heuristic, greedy algorithm with regret, traveling salesman problem Introduction leghorn rooster picturesWebwhile True: current_cost = 0 k = s for i in range (len (vertex)): current_cost += graph [k] [vertex [i]] k = vertex [i] current_cost += graph [k] [s] min_path = min (min_path, current_cost) if not next_perm (vertex): break return min_path def next_perm (l): n = len (l) i = n-2 while i >= 0 and l [i] > l [i+1]: i -= 1 if i == -1: return False leghorn stream